The FDA oversees the FDA-mandated testing and approval processes that pharmaceutical manufacturers must follow when developing a new drug. This is to ensure any potential risks are discovered. However, even with this oversight, errors can occur during the development process which could lead to the release of a dangerous drug. If a drug that is dangerous causes illness or injury, a victim can seek damages, however, they must prove that their injuries were directly resulted from a manufacturing defect, a design defect, or irresponsible marketing.

Manufacturing defects can arise when a drug's manufacturing process goes wrong. This can result in a medication that is different from the original plan of the manufacturer. This could result in contamination, incorrect dosages, or impurities that can cause harm to patients. Design flaws are a result of defects in a medication's overall structure or formulation that make it unintentionally dangerous, no matter how well it's manufactured or marketed.

Irresponsible marketing is a type of misleading advertising that occurs when a pharmaceutical firm or sales representative misleads doctors and consumers by exaggerating the benefits of a drug or downplaying any risks. Additionally, a marketing defect could be present if the warning label isn't clear or simple to comprehend and dangerous drugs lawsuit includes insufficient information about proper dosage or potential side effects.

Damages

Modern medicine has created many medicines that can boost health and extend life however, these drugs can be risky. Dangerous drug suits can offer injured plaintiffs to recover compensation for their losses. These damages could include medical expenses for any treatment that was required by the drug, lost income, emotional distress, as well as suffering and pain. In rare cases punitive damages are also granted. Based on the specific facts of your situation, you may be able to make a claim for dangerous drugs as part of a class action lawsuit or you could seek damages on your own by filing an individual dangerous drug lawsuit.

Damages that are awarded in lawsuits involving dangerous drugs can be wildly different depending on the degree of the injury being a significant factor. In addition there are a variety of variables that can impact the amount of money awarded, including the age of the victim as well as the time period before their injury happened.

A Michigan dangerous drugs attorney may be able to assist a client seek fair compensation even though proving a connection between the drug being used and the harm suffered can be difficult. These claims must meet strict legal standards to be paid and pharmaceutical companies typically employ robust legal defenses to undermine the evidence of harm caused by drugs.

A defective drug could be blamed on a number of people, but the majority of the blame is usually placed on the drug's manufacturer. Nurses and doctors who prescribe the medication could be held liable for not informing patients of potential side effects. In addition, pharmacists could be liable for failing to properly label the drugs.

The FDA tests all drugs before they are released to the public, but errors can happen. Sometimes, a medication is mistakenly mixed with another substance or mislabeled, which can cause harm to people who are taking the wrong dosage. Drugs that aren't properly stored or handled during shipping may also be contaminated, and could pose a risk to the consumer.
